דּוּמִיָּהdûwmîyâh/doo-me-yaw'/
HebrewH17474 occurrences (KJV)
stillness; adverbially, silently; abstractly quiet, trust
KJV renders it: silence, silent, waiteth.
Where it appears
- Ps 22:2My God, I cry in the daytime, but you don’t answer; in the night season, and am not silent.
- Ps 39:2I was mute with silence. I held my peace, even from good. My sorrow was stirred.
- Ps 62:1For the Chief Musician. To Jeduthun. A Psalm by David. My soul rests in God alone. My salvation is from him.
- Ps 65:1For the Chief Musician. A Psalm by David. A song. Praise waits for you, God, in Zion. To you shall vows be performed.
